Mitski announces upcoming album, Nothing’s About to Happen to Me

16 January 2026, 13:50 | Written by Kayla Sandiford

Mitski has revealed the details of her upcoming eighth album, Nothing’s About to Happen to Me, and released lead single, “Where’s My Phone?”.

Over the past week, Mitsuki Laycock has taken to social media to share cryptic teasers, including a “WHERE’S MY PHONE?” hotline, quickly sparking fan speculation around new music coming imminently. Today, she shares new single “Where’s My Phone?”, the first taster of Nothing’s About to Happen to Me, released at the end of February

Laycock wrote all of the songs and performed all of the vocals on Nothing’s About to Happen to Me. Produced and engineered by Patrick Hyland and mastered by Bob Weston, the album continues the musical through line established with 2023’s The Land Is Inhospitable and So Are We, and features live instrumentation by The Land touring band and ensemble arrangements.

Nothing’s About to Happen to Me is released on 27 February via Dead Oceans
